Apple sets October debut for iPhone Duo foldable phone

by thenational.net.in September 16, 2026
September 16, 2026
3

CUPERTINO, CALIFORNIA / RankWire.AI / – Apple has added a foldable model to the iPhone lineup with the debut of the iPhone Duo. The company introduced the device on Sept. 9, ahead of preorders opening Oct. 16. U.S. pricing begins at $1,999, while the starting price in the UAE is AED 8,499. Sales will begin Oct. 23 in more than 70 countries and regions. The launch gives Apple its first book-style smartphone with separate outer and inner displays.

The iPhone Duo carries a 5.4-inch external screen for everyday phone use when the device stays closed. Opening the handset reveals a 7.6-inch Super Retina XDR display designed for larger apps and multitasking. Both panels support ProMotion and Always-On features, with outdoor brightness reaching 3,000 nits. Apple uses Grade 5 titanium for the enclosure and built the hinge from more than 100 components. The phone also carries an IP68 rating for resistance to water and dust.

Software plays a central role in how the foldable iPhone uses its extra screen area. Apple designed iOS 27.1 to support both open and closed modes. Split View lets people place two apps beside each other on the internal display. Users can also run two windows from the same app and save app combinations for later access. The expanded screen supports two Home Screen pages, while Touch ID remains integrated into the side button.

Larger display brings new multitasking options to iPhone

The camera system includes a 48-megapixel Fusion Main camera and a 48-megapixel Fusion Ultra Wide camera. The main sensor also offers an optical-quality 2x telephoto setting. Duo Preview can show subjects a live image on the outside display while another person takes the picture. The outer screen also works as a viewfinder for selfies taken with the rear cameras. Video recording reaches 4K resolution at up to 120 frames per second with Dolby Vision support.

Apple equipped the iPhone Duo with the A20 Pro processor, built with 2-nanometer chip technology. The processor includes a six-core CPU, seven-core GPU and dual 16-core Neural Engine. A vapor chamber supports thermal control inside the foldable body. Apple also placed a battery on each side of the device. The company lists up to 31 hours of video playback on the inner display and up to 44 hours on the outer screen.

October release brings Apple into foldable smartphone segment

Storage starts at 256GB and extends through 512GB, 1TB and 2TB options. Apple will sell the iPhone Duo in star white and night sky finishes. The first retail rollout starts Oct. 23 after the preorder period begins one week earlier. Another 28 countries and regions will receive the device on Oct. 30. The handset uses an eSIM-only design worldwide and supports Wi-Fi 7, Bluetooth 6 and Thread connectivity.

The iPhone Duo places Apple in a foldable smartphone market that already includes devices from several major manufacturers. Its layout combines a standard outer phone screen with a larger internal workspace for apps, photos and video. Apple has integrated that hardware with its own chips, operating system and camera features. The company also kept familiar iPhone functions, including biometric authentication and its existing software ecosystem. Customers will receive the first units about six weeks after the September announcement.
